Lapalud enjoys a temperate climate with an average annual temperature of 58°F (14°C). Winters average 41°F in January while summers reach 76°F in July. The area gets 307 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 35.9 inches. The area receives 2.6 inches of snow annually.

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 41°F (5°C) | 2.8 in | Coldest |
| February | 44°F (7°C) | 2.1 in | |
| March | 49°F (10°C) | 2.3 in | |
| April | 54°F (12°C) | 2.9 in | |
| May | 62°F (17°C) | 3.0 in | |
| June | 69°F (21°C) | 2.1 in | |
| July | 76°F (25°C) | 1.4 in | Warmest, Driest |
| August | 74°F (23°C) | 2.1 in | |
| September | 67°F (19°C) | 3.7 in | |
| October | 58°F (14°C) | 5.2 in | Wettest |
| November | 48°F (9°C) | 2.8 in | |
| December | 43°F (6°C) | 2.6 in |
Lapalud has a seasonal temperature swing of 35°F / from 41°F in January to 76°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 33.1 inches, with October being the wettest month (5.2") and July the driest (1.4").
